A Rumble Of Engines

A Rumble of Engines is a collective noun phrase used to describe the melodious sound produced by multiple engines running simultaneously. It brings to mind the fascinating combination of power and precision as a group of engines harmoniously rumble, creating a unique and captivating auditory experience. The phrase conveys a sense of energy, vigor, and efficiency, evoking images of powerful machinery at work or vehicles in motion, such as racing cars, motorcycles, planes, or even boats. Using 'Rumble Of Engines' in a Sentence

  1. The rumble of engines roared through the air as the motorcycle rally took off down the open road.
  2. The ground trembled beneath me, vibrations of power reverberating with each rumble of engines.
  3. As the car race began, a tremendous rumble of engines filled the stadium, drowning out all other sounds.
